«Если рабочий хочет хорошо выполнять свою работу, он должен сначала заточить свои инструменты» — Конфуций, «Аналитики Конфуция. Лу Лингун»
титульная страница > программирование > Почему мой запрос SQLite выходит из строя с «Нижней строкой 83: синтаксическая ошибка» при создании таблицы «транзакции»?

Почему мой запрос SQLite выходит из строя с «Нижней строкой 83: синтаксическая ошибка» при создании таблицы «транзакции»?

Опубликовано в 2025-02-26
Просматривать:304

Why Does My SQLite Query Fail with

раскрыть неуловимую ошибку синтаксиса SQLite

вы сталкиваетесь с криптической "ближней строкой 83: ошибка синтаксиса" при создании таблицы "Transaction. " Эта ошибка может быть озадачена, но решение заключается в понимании зарезервированных ключевых слов SQLite. Это означает, что SQLite использует его внутри, для конкретных целей. Попытка использовать зарезервированное имя в качестве имени таблицы приведет к упомянутой ошибке синтаксиса.

Решение проблемы

, чтобы исправить эту проблему, у вас есть два варианта:

переименовать таблицу:

выберите имя для вашей таблицы, которое не зарезервировано name.

    цитируйте имя таблицы:
  1. зарегистрированное имя в Single ('Tranc. Цитата отметки. Это сообщает SQLite, что вы используете имя буквально, а не как зарезервированный ключевой слово. ... ); ]
  2. обратите внимание, что использование знаков цитаты в SQL не совпадает с использованием типа строкости данных в языках программирования. Успешно создать таблицу «транзакции» и продолжить проверку целостности ваших иностранных ключей.
Последний учебник Более>

Изучайте китайский

Отказ от ответственности: Все предоставленные ресурсы частично взяты из Интернета. В случае нарушения ваших авторских прав или других прав и интересов, пожалуйста, объясните подробные причины и предоставьте доказательства авторских прав или прав и интересов, а затем отправьте их по электронной почте: [email protected]. Мы сделаем это за вас как можно скорее.

Copyright© 2022 湘ICP备2022001581号-3